Summary

Today Mark and Paul Markel, Student of the Gun discuss the recent move by the US Senate parliamentarian to remove the suppressor and SHORT act from the Trump reconciliation bill. What process does that leave for the US Senate and House to move the bill forward with both measures intact to stop the NFA of these unconstitutional infringements on our right to bear arms. Also, the ATF was in the crosshairs again today as DOGE has been instructed to remove up to 50 unconstitutional regulations that hinder American's right to keep and bear arms.
